The only thing better than getting closer to your goal weight is looking like you’re even closer to your goal weight! Check out some of my top tips for dressing slimmer:
Wearing any dark color, be it navy, dark brown or black, from head to toe is slimming, particularly if you wear garments that are the right cut for your body frame (Nobody looks good in those tent-like dresses … even in black!).
If your pants are too short they can make you look heavier, particularly if, like me, you are on the short side. A longer line — covering most of your shoe — will create longer-looking legs and an overall leaner look.
Choose a baby-doll style top to minimize your midsection. Choosing one with a vertical pattern will help make you look even more slender.
If you’re full-busted, consider trying a turtle neck and choose round necklines whenever possible. Look for tops that are form-fitting, but not clingy.
Dress shopping isn’t exactly simple for us plus size gals, but with a few of these tips in mind, it’s easier:
If you have a thick waistline, look for wrap dresses that tie below your waist or an empire-style dress that sits above it.
Got an hourglass figure? Pick a dress with a defined waist that is cut a little higher on the side to make your torso look slimmer and minimize belly bulges.
Is your belly pooch your trouble spot? Be sure to avoid any extra fabrics at the middle because the extra material will add bulk to your belly.
